On Friday evening, Michael Judge will be speaking at 7:30 in Rose Hall on "Christ as the Lord of Evolution -- Reconciling Spiritual Science and Natural Science." He will address the three sacrifices and four deeds of Christ in evolution, as seen in the geological, paleontological and archeological records. Rudolf Steiner observes that genuine spiritual science and genuine natural science will always agree. Michael has discovered and will present a coherent and plausible correspondence of these two sciences as a basis for further research.
On Saturday afternoon, from 3:00 to 5:00 in Rose Hall, Michael will give a workshop showing the grand picture of coherence between the fossil record and the spiritual scientific description of the Lemurian and Atlantean stages of Earth evolution. He welcomes questions from the audience, and will share the open questions in the field of natural science that would benefit from considering the results of spiritual science.
Michael Judge was born in Washington DC near the Smithsonian Natural History Museum to Irish immigrant parents. Michael has had a keen interest in the past since being a young lad. He graduated from the University of Maryland with a BA in History where he also studied geology, anthropology, and archeology.
He has also held the State of Maryland Teacher Certification completing the course work.
Michael encountered Anthroposophy in 1978 reading Cosmic Memory by Rudolf Steiner. The precise descriptions in the book were striking yet of seeming fantastic nature and content. There and then an urge to show the plausible coherence of evolution between Natural Science and Spiritual Science was born.
It continues to this day 46 years on.
Michael has worked in business, some Anthroposophical in nature. He has worked as a conventional educator and he is a Waldorf Teacher. He holds a Waldorf Teaching Certificate, a Spacial Dynamics Institute Certificate, and attended multiple sessions of the Rudolf Steiner Institute. He founded and coordinates the Chesapeake BioDynamic Network linking biodynamic endeavors in the greater Chesapeake Region (VA, MD, DE, DC, WV).
He has presented widely since 2010 looking to resolve Rudolf Steiner's picture of Evolution as a Spiritual Scientist with the conventional Natural Scientific picture of Evolution.
